INSTALL ADDITIONAL MEMORY 420: MEMORY OVERFLOW The Problem The amount of data in the file being printed has exceeded the printer’s memory. What to Do • Reduce the size of the file being printed (e.g., print the file as separate groups of pages instead of all the pages at one time).

Error Messages (cont.) SET XXX ON MPTRAY AND PUSH ON-LINE SWITCH The Problem The printer has received a job for printing from the Multi-Purpose Tray and no media is loaded in the tray. What to Do Load the requested media ( the Multi-Purpose Tray, then press ON LINE.
